Transaction e876fc43c1a2e575916effa7f149eecd7fc767ee65d93622470e2861ff1c79c3

1 Input
2 Outputs
  • e876fc43c1a2e575916effa7f149eecd7fc767ee65d93622470e2861ff1c79c3:0
  • value  10613
    address  3M8wkEpgCH5uqYzSmTwtkVZKKzGMvmNms5
  • e876fc43c1a2e575916effa7f149eecd7fc767ee65d93622470e2861ff1c79c3:1
  • value  55319205
    address  3QEsZAd3zQGTpNXyEpatp887zj6wmXnvxD